Description

House dates back to the 16th century but was rebuilt in the 18th century. 18th/19th century gardens (?), first mentioned by Sheahan as '..well laid down and planted grounds.' Also on the first edition 6" OS map. They are situated immediately adjacent to Hartwell House gardens. They contain only lawns and a tennis court and are not considered to be of any obvious interest.
